This is an older iconv character-conversion flaw reported for FreeBSD 10.0 before p6 and NetBSD. A program that passes attacker-controlled conversion names into iconv_open could crash, causing denial of service. The CVE record is ambiguous because it says the NULL pointer issue was later split to CVE-2014-5384. Exposure is most likely on legacy FreeBSD 10.0 pre-p6 or affected NetBSD systems where applications call iconv_open with untrusted or semi-trusted charset parameters. Modern patched systems are less likely exposed, but the bundle does not provide full fixed-version details for NetBSD. Prioritize this for legacy BSD estate cleanup and service-stability risk. It is not supported as actively exploited or remotely exploitable by itself, but unpatched systems running input-processing services could face avoidable crashes. Mitigation focus: Apply FreeBSD security updates covering FreeBSD-SA-14:15.iconv.; Check NetBSD source/vendor advisories for the corresponding libc citrus iconv fix.; Inventory applications that accept user-controlled charset or encoding names..
